Chicken Shawarma with Tabbouleh Bulgur

This dish combines the rich, spiced flavors of chicken shawarma with a refreshing tabbouleh bulgur salad. It's a vibrant and satisfying meal perfect for lunch or dinner.

medium 60 min 550 cal
Steps

1. Marinate the chicken breast with shawarma spice mix, olive oil, salt, and pepper for at least 30 minutes. 2. Cook the bulgur by boiling water, adding bulgur, and simmering for about 15 minutes until fluffy. 3. In a bowl, combine cooked bulgur, parsley, tomatoes, cucumber, lemon juice, salt, and pepper to make tabbouleh. 4. Grill or pan-fry the marinated chicken over medium heat for about 6-7 minutes on each side until cooked through. 5. Slice the chicken thinly and serve it over the tabbouleh bulgur with pita bread on the side, if desired.

Ingredients

150g chicken breast 1 tsp shawarma spice mix 1 tbsp olive oil 1/2 cup bulgur 1 cup water 1/4 cup parsley, finely chopped 1/4 cup tomatoes, diced 1/4 cup cucumber, diced 1 tbsp lemon juice Salt and pepper to taste Pita bread for serving (optional)
